Setting up Key Marketing Objectives
1. Understand Your Target Audience
- Identify the demographics of potential customers (age, location, income level, cycling frequency).
- Assess their needs and preferences, such as convenience, pricing, and types of bike services required.
2. Conduct Market Research
- Analyze local competitors and their offerings.
- Gather insights on market trends in the cycling community and mobile services.
- Utilize surveys or focus groups to understand customer pain points and preferences.
3. Define Your Unique Selling Proposition (USP)
- Determine what sets your mobile bicycle repair service apart from others (e.g., quick response times, specialized repairs, eco-friendly practices).
- Highlight any additional services that can enhance customer experience (e.g., bike cleaning, tune-ups, or custom fittings).
4. Set SMART Objectives
- Create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ound goals for your marketing efforts.
- Examples may include increasing website traffic by 30% in six months or gaining 100 new customers in the first quarter.
5. Establish Brand Awareness Goals
- Set objectives focused on increasing recognition and recall of your brand within the local cycling community.
- Aim for a specific percentage increase in social media followings, newsletter sign-ups, or engagement metrics.
6. Develop Customer Acquisition Goals
- Define targets for how many new customers you aim to attract through various channels (e.g., social media, word-of-mouth, local events).
- Plan strategies to convert leads into paying customers (e.g., offering discounts for first-time users).
7. Focus on Customer Retention
- Set goals for repeat business, such as achieving a 25% increase in returning customers within a year.
- Implement loyalty programs or referral incentives to encourage ongoing patronage.
8. Measure Marketing Effectiveness
- Identify key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the success of each marketing tactic (e.g., conversion rates, customer feedback, return on investment).
- Regularly review and adjust strategies based on performance data.
9. Expand Market Reach
- Establish objectives to enter new markets or service areas, such as expanding to neighboring towns within the next year.
- Assess the potential for diversifying services based on customer demand (e.g., offering rental bikes or accessories).
10. Utilize Digital Marketing Goals
- Set objectives for online visibility, such as achieving a specific ranking on search engines for relevant keywords.
- Plan to increase engagement on social media platforms through regular content updates and interactions with followers. By establishing clear marketing objectives, your mobile bicycle repair business can effectively strategize and track progress, ensuring alignment with overall business goals.

Digital Marketing Strategies for Mobile Bicycle Repair businesses
1. Search Engine Optimization (SEO):
- Keyword Research: Identify keywords that potential customers might use when searching for mobile bicycle repair services. Focus on local SEO terms like "mobile bike repair in [City]" or "bike repair near me."
- On-Page SEO: Optimize the website content by including targeted keywords in titles, headers, and throughout the text. Ensure that your website is mobile-friendly and has fast loading times to improve user experience.
- Local Listings: Create and optimize Google My Business and Bing Places profiles. Ensure that all information, such as service hours, contact details, and location, is accurate. Encourage satisfied customers to leave positive reviews to enhance credibility.
- Content Marketing: Develop a blog that covers topics like bike maintenance tips, cycling routes, and the benefits of mobile repair services. This not only helps with SEO but positions you as an authority in the bicycle repair niche.
2. Social Media Marketing:
- Platform Selection: Focus on platforms where your target audience is most active, such as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ter. Create visually appealing content showcasing before-and-after repair pictures, customer testimonials, and cycling tips.
- Engagement: Actively engage with your audience by responding to comments and messages promptly. Host Q&A sessions or live demonstrations of bike repairs to foster community interaction.
- Local Community Involvement: Share posts about local cycling events, partnerships with local bike shops, or sponsorship of community cycling events. This can help build a loyal following within the local cycling community.
- User-Generated Content: Encourage customers to share photos of their bikes after service and tag your business. This not only promotes authenticity but also increases your visibility through their networks.
3. Pay-Per-Click Advertising (PPC):
- Google Ads: Create local PPC campaigns targeting keywords such as "mobile bicycle repair" or "bike repairs near me." Utilize location targeting to ensure your ads reach customers looking for services in your area.
- Social Media Ads: Use Facebook and Instagram ads to reach a targeted audience. Create visually compelling ads that highlight your unique selling propositions, such as convenience, quality service, and quick turnaround times.
- Retargeting Campaigns: Implement retargeting ads to reach visitors who have previously interacted with your website or social media profiles. This can help keep your services top-of-mind and encourage potential customers to book your services.
- Promotions and Discounts: Use PPC campaigns to promote special offers or discounts for first-time customers. This can incentivize potential clients to choose your service over competitors. By combining these digital marketing strategies, a Mobile Bicycle Repair business can effectively reach its target audience, build a strong brand presence online, and ultimately drive more bookings and customer loyalty.
Offline Marketing Strategies for Mobile Bicycle Repair businesses
1. Local Partnerships: Collaborate with local bike shops, gyms, and community centers to promote your services. Offer to leave flyers or business cards at their locations, or create joint promotions to reach a wider audience.
2. Community Events: Participate in local events such as farmers' markets, fairs, and cycling events. Set up a booth, offer free bike inspections, or provide discounts for on-the-spot repairs to attract potential customers.
3. Sponsorship Opportunities: Sponsor local cycling clubs or community races. This not only increases your visibility but also builds credibility within the cycling community.
4. Public Relations: Write press releases to announce your business launch, special promotions, or community involvement. Distribute them to local newspapers, magazines, and online community boards to gain media coverage.
5. Workshops and Clinics: Host workshops on basic bike maintenance or repair techniques. This positions you as an expert while providing valuable information to cyclists in the community.
6. Networking Events: Attend local business networking events or join chambers of commerce to meet other local business owners and promote your services through word-of-mouth referrals.
7. Print Advertising: Utilize local newspapers, magazines, or community newsletters to run advertisements. Consider placing ads in cycling-specific publications to target a more focused audience.
8. Flyers and Posters: Create eye-catching flyers or posters to distribute in your local area. Focus on high-traffic locations such as coffee shops, gyms, and universities where cyclists frequent.
9. Customer Referral Program: Implement a referral program that rewards existing customers for bringing in new clients. This could be in the form of discounts on future services, creating a word-of-mouth marketing effect.
10. Branded Merchandise: Create branded merchandise such as t-shirts, water bottles, or bike accessories. These can be sold or given away at events, serving as a walking advertisement for your business.
11. Local Direct Mail Campaigns: Design a direct mail campaign targeting local residents who are likely to own bicycles. Include special offers, promotions, or seasonal tips for bike maintenance.
12. Community Boards and Libraries: Post your services on community bulletin boards or in local libraries. These are often frequented by residents looking for local services and can help you reach a broader audience.
13. Collaborative Promotions: Partner with local businesses to create promotional packages. For instance, team up with a coffee shop to offer discounts for customers who show a receipt from either business.
14. Seasonal Promotions: Use holidays or cycling events to run seasonal promotions or limited-time offers. Advertise these through print media, community boards, and local events to generate buzz.
15. Customer Testimonials and Case Studies: Highlight success stories of your repairs or satisfied customers in local publications or on community websites to build trust and encourage word-of-mouth referrals.

1. What is a mobile bicycle repair business? A mobile bicycle repair business provides on-site bicycle maintenance and repair services. Instead of a fixed shop location, technicians travel to customers' homes or workplaces to perform repairs, tune-ups, and maintenance on bicycles. ####
2. Why is a marketing plan important for a mobile bicycle repair business? A marketing plan helps define your target audience, set clear goals, and outline strategies to attract and retain customers. It is essential for establishing your brand presence, increasing visibility, and driving sales in a competitive market. ####
3. Who is my target audience for a mobile bicycle repair service? Your target audience may include casual cyclists, commuters, competitive cyclists, families with children, and local cycling clubs. Understanding their needs and preferences will help tailor your marketing strategies effectively. ####

6. What role does local SEO play in my marketing plan? Local SEO is crucial for attracting customers who search for bicycle repair services nearby. Optimize your Google My Business listing, use local keywords in your website content, and gather customer reviews to improve your search visibility and credibility. ####
7. How can I measure the success of my marketing plan? You can measure success through key performance indicators (KPIs) such as website traffic, social media engagement, customer acquisition costs, and overall sales growth. Tools like Google Analytics and social media insights can help track your progress. ####
8. What budget should I allocate for marketing a mobile bicycle repair business? Your marketing budget will depend on your overall business goals and resources. A general guideline is to allocate 10-15% of your projected revenue for marketing. Start with low-cost strategies like social media and local SEO, then gradually invest in paid advertising as your business grows. ####
